The extract from Elliot Page’s ‘gender transition’ memoir Pageboy, included in the new WJEC English GCSE specification, promotes tired gender stereotypes and pushes a highly-controversial view about sex and gender. Using this text in the classroom risks violating schools’ responsibility to be politically neutral.

‘Pageboy’ is a memoir written by actor Elliot (formerly Ellen) Page, most famous for an Academy-Award nominated role as a pregnant teenage girl in the film ‘Juno’. In the book, Page talks about experiences of sexual assault, objectification and harassment, and how becoming a ‘trans man’ through hormones and surgery has been a liberating experience.
